As temperatures soar across Europe, the continent is experiencing the harsh realities of climate change firsthand. Recent studies have shown that global warming has increased the intensity of heatwaves by a staggering 2-4°C. This alarming trend not only highlights the urgency of addressing climate change but also poses serious threats to public health, agriculture, and our natural ecosystems.

The Rising Temperatures: What You Need to Know

Europe is warming faster than any other region in the world, with significant implications for its inhabitants and wildlife. The increase in average temperatures has resulted in a series of extreme weather patterns, particularly heatwaves that have become more frequent and severe.

Understanding the Causes

  • Greenhouse Gas Emissions: A primary driver of climate change, emissions from industrial activities have significantly contributed to the warming.
  • Deforestation: The loss of forests removes vital carbon sinks, exacerbating the greenhouse effect.
  • Urbanization: Expanding cities create heat islands, trapping heat and elevating local temperatures.

The Impact of Heatwaves

Heatwaves have a multitude of adverse effects that are already being felt across Europe:

  • Public Health Risks: Higher temperatures lead to increased cases of heat-related illnesses, particularly among vulnerable populations.
  • Water Scarcity: Prolonged heat can severely diminish water supplies, impacting both drinking water and agricultural irrigation.
  • Agricultural Challenges: Crops are being stressed by extreme temperatures, leading to reduced yields and food security concerns.

Taking Action Against Climate Change

To combat the escalating crisis, a multifaceted approach is essential:

  • Invest in Renewable Energy: Transitioning from fossil fuels to renewable energy sources can significantly reduce greenhouse gas emissions.
  • Enhance Energy Efficiency: Upgrading infrastructure to be more energy-efficient can help lower overall energy consumption.
  • Promote Sustainable Practices: Encouraging sustainable agricultural and forestry practices can mitigate environmental impacts.

Community Engagement and Education

To foster a culture of sustainability, community awareness and education are critical. Initiatives that educate citizens about the effects of climate change and how to reduce their carbon footprints can create a collective impact.

The Role of Policy in Climate Mitigation

Governments play a crucial role in implementing effective policies that prioritize climate action:

  • Carbon Pricing: Implementing taxes or cap-and-trade systems can incentivize reductions in carbon emissions.
  • Regulating Industries: Enforcing stricter regulations on industries known for high emissions can drive significant change.
  • International Cooperation: Climate change is a global issue that requires collaborative solutions across borders.
